My work is about unknowing, searching, wondering, and finding a balance

among these fluctuating states of being. I gravitate to places where land meets sky and ocean.

Walking is my muse, in rugged working harbors, or at the edge of the sea.

I spend a long time looking, and find what moves me, by closely observing relationships

of shapes, values, and colors, along with the beauty of light and how it influences

and constantly changes everything. I begin by drawing random lines and shapes,

and quickly erase or thinly veil most of my first marks, in order to keep myself and the work in flux

as I build a history of layers. I aim to transport myself and the viewer into a moment of

surprising and unknown beauty, as I aim for a strong, yet open arrangement of visual elements.
